This product works great to improve the audio on my Go Pro Hero 8 Black. It allows you to plug in a microphone and charge via USB C at the same time - critical for my YouTube videos. I can now connect my Rode wireless lapel mic for much improved audio. One thing to know: Powering up the GoPro by voice does not seem to work with any external mic, but once powered up, all voice commands work fine.

A good alternative to the Media Mod for Hero 10
Since the Media Mod has issues making a good connection and overheats the GoPro Hero 10, this one works well along side a camera door with a flap cover for the USB-C port. It basically provides the same functions as the media mod, but costs a little less and actually makes a connection.Here are some negatives about this product:1. You'll either need to run your camera without a side door or get a side door that has a pass-through port for the USB-C connection. So this will be an extra cost.2. The media mod would display a level indicator on the screen (one of the only ways to know if it's actually connected). This unit does not display anything. That is a nice feature to know how much noise you are receiving along with the audio.3. This is more of a complaint about GoPro's product strategy. Why do I need to spend so much money to attach an external microphone? It's ridiculous. But I suppose that is a complaint about why this product needs to exist rather than the product itself.Overall, I'm happy with my purchase and will use it while trying to sell the media mod that it replaced.

With this adapter, your audio will be as crystal clear as your video.A crucial point to highlight is the importance of having the right audio cable. If you want this adapter to work its best, use a TRS to TRS cable. The TRRS to TRS cable you get with your phone accessories won't give you the best performance.
